PRIVACY, IN PLAIN LANGUAGE.
BIMZI only needs enough information to understand your message and reply. No third-party advertising or analytics script is loaded in this build.
WHAT THE CONTACT FORM COLLECTS
- Your name and email address.
- Optional phone, company, time zone and preferred call windows.
- The project note you choose to send.
WHY IT IS USED
To review your project, reply to you and arrange a conversation when you ask for one. The form also uses a hidden anti-spam field and an idempotency identifier so the same request is not stored twice by accident.
WHERE A SUBMISSION GOES
Development submissions stay in the local project environment. A public launch must use an approved private database or a named form provider, with a working operator notification route and access limited to the person handling BIMZI inquiries.
BEFORE PUBLIC LAUNCH
The final notice must name the responsible business contact, approved processor and retention period, and explain how a person can request access, correction or deletion. The contact form must not be advertised until those production settings are complete.
